#ifndef P4_TO_P8
#include <p4est_connectivity.h>
#include <p4est_ghost.h>
#include <p4est_lnodes.h>
#else
#include <p8est_connectivity.h>
#include <p8est_ghost.h>
#include <p8est_lnodes.h>
#endif
static void
test_the_p4est (p4est_connectivity_t * conn, int N)
{
p4est_t *p4est;
p4est_ghost_t *ghost;
p4est_lnodes_t *lnodes;
p4est = p4est_new (sc_MPI_COMM_WORLD, conn, 0, NULL, NULL);
ghost = p4est_ghost_new (p4est, P4EST_CONNECT_FULL);
lnodes = p4est_lnodes_new (p4est, ghost, N);
p4est_lnodes_destroy (lnodes);
p4est_ghost_destroy (ghost);
p4est_destroy (p4est);
}
static void
test_complete (p4est_connectivity_t * conn, const char *which, int test_p4est)
{
SC_GLOBAL_INFOF ("Testing standard connectivity %s\n", which);
SC_CHECK_ABORTF (p4est_connectivity_is_valid (conn),
"Invalid connectivity %s before completion", which);
if (0 && test_p4est) {
test_the_p4est (conn, 3);
}
SC_GLOBAL_INFOF ("Testing completion for connectivity %s\n", which);
p4est_connectivity_complete (conn);
SC_CHECK_ABORTF (p4est_connectivity_is_valid (conn),
"Invalid connectivity %s after completion", which);
if (test_p4est) {
test_the_p4est (conn, 3);
}
p4est_connectivity_destroy (conn);
}
int
main (int argc, char **argv)
{
int mpiret;
mpiret = sc_MPI_Init (&argc, &argv);
SC_CHECK_MPI (mpiret);
sc_init (sc_MPI_COMM_WORLD, 1, 1, NULL, SC_LP_DEFAULT);
p4est_init (NULL, SC_LP_DEFAULT);
#ifndef P4_TO_P8
test_complete (p4est_connectivity_new_unitsquare (), "unitsquare", 1);
test_complete (p4est_connectivity_new_periodic (), "2D periodic", 0);
test_complete (p4est_connectivity_new_rotwrap (), "rotwrap", 0);
test_complete (p4est_connectivity_new_corner (), "corner", 1);
test_complete (p4est_connectivity_new_moebius (), "moebius", 1);
test_complete (p4est_connectivity_new_star (), "star", 1);
test_complete (p4est_connectivity_new_brick (3, 18, 0, 1),
"2D periodic brick", 0);
test_complete (p4est_connectivity_new_brick (3, 18, 0, 0), "2D brick", 1);
#else
test_complete (p8est_connectivity_new_unitcube (), "unitcube", 1);
test_complete (p8est_connectivity_new_periodic (), "3D periodic", 0);
test_complete (p8est_connectivity_new_rotwrap (), "rotwrap", 0);
test_complete (p8est_connectivity_new_twowrap (), "twowrap", 1);
test_complete (p8est_connectivity_new_twocubes (), "twocubes", 1);
test_complete (p8est_connectivity_new_rotcubes (), "rotcubes", 1);
test_complete (p8est_connectivity_new_brick (3, 2, 8, 1, 0, 1),
"3D periodic brick", 0);
test_complete (p8est_connectivity_new_brick (3, 2, 8, 0, 0, 0),
"3D brick", 1);
#endif
sc_finalize ();
mpiret = sc_MPI_Finalize ();
SC_CHECK_MPI (mpiret);
return 0;
}
